[en] Introduction of sesame germplasm from Myanmar and Mexico was not satisfactory for successful development of the Australian sesame industry. Therefore, a national breeding programme was undertaken by CSIRO and the Northern Territory Department of Primary Industry and Fisheries (NTDPIF). The main traits considered for selection were latitudinal adaptation, temperature response, growth habit, determinacy, palatability, capsules per leaf axil, seed shattering and seed dormancy. The CSIRO breeding efforts started in 1989 with a hybridization programme using germplasm from Japan, Mexico, Myanmar, Rep. of Korea and Venezuela. This programme resulted in selection in the F6 generation of branched types released under the names 'Beech's choice' and 'Aussie Gold'. The NTDPIF sesame breeding programme started in 1993 with hybridization of introductions. The Mexican cultivar 'Yori 77' was selected for release, and after several years of intraline selection the uniculm cultivar 'Edith' was released in 1996. Further breeding continues to improve seed retention and resistance to charcoal rot. (author)
